Tono Stano (24 3 1960, Slovakia; lives in Prague) is one of the best-known photographers working in Central Europe, with connections all over the world. He has developed a characteristic style based on staged photography, but his work also includes traditional approaches such as portraiture, landscape photography and installations, as well as very experimental series and conceptual photography. He is connected to contemporary visual art, which inspires him to new forms of artistic expression. Tono Stano’s oeuvre is very extensive – the retrospective exhibition at the Municipal Library will present works created during his time at secondary school, which are surprising in their openness, inventiveness and sense of cinematic vision, as well as current work, ingenious portraits and works combining both painting and photographic processes.
A reprise of the exhibition, which took place at the GHMP in 2025, can be seen at the Danubiana Gallery in Bratislava until the beginning of March 2026.
